With a one-timer on the feed from Evgeni Malkin, Sidney Crosby recorded his 500th NHL goal on a Penguins power-play to give Pittsburgh a 2-1 lead late in the first period vs the Philadelphia Flyers on Feb. 15, 2022. Notably, this was also Crosby's 50th goal against the Flyers, his most against any team at the time. Sidney Crosby joined Alex Ovechkin as the only active player to score 500 goals. The Penguins claimed victory with a 5-4 win over the Flyers after Kris Letang scored an overtime goal just 31 seconds into play.
Sidney Crosby became just the 46th NHL player to score 500 goals, and the first since Patrick Marleau with the San Jose Sharks on Feb. 2, 2017. Crosby, who has scored 24 goals so far this 2022-23 season, is the second player to score 500 for Pittsburgh, joining Mario Lemieux (690).
